Paul Pelosi was granted his freedom early on Sunday morning after serving his time in jail.
Paul Pelosi, the husband of Nancy Pelosi, the speaker of the House of Representatives, was taken into custody late Saturday night on suspicion of driving under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
When Paul Pelosi was apprehended in Napa County, California, at 11:44 p.m. on Saturday, he was suspected of both drivings under the influence of alcohol as well as operating a motor vehicle while inebriated.
